The emirates news Agency Wam said use presi Dent sheikh Zayid bin Sultan Al Sahyan sunday received saudi ambassador Saleh Al Kowzan who delivered the idler dealing with the situation in the International Oil Market and efforts to stabilize a Sahyan is the current chairman of the Gulf co operation Council a cd a Loose defensive and economic Alliance be up in 1981 by saudi Arabia Kuwait the use Qatar Oman and Bahrain. The first tour Stales Are also members of the organization of Petroleum exporting countries. Gulf officials said saudi Arabia open s principal producer is trying to Muster a unified Gulf Arab Posi Tion on a new policy for a so a barrel Price before the next meeting of open scheduled in Geneva dec. Ii. The saudi Monarch saturday also sent a message to Qatar s Sheik Khalifa bin Hamad a Thani he qatari news Agency reported. The new move came less than 24 hours after the new saudi Oil minister Hisham Nazca unveiled what appeared to be a diplomatic Campaign involving Oil producers inside and outside open to prop up Oil prices Nazer replaces sheikh Ahmed Zaki Yamani who was widely associated with the now abandoned Price War strategy to win a larger share in the or Oral Oil Market. Overproduction by nearly All of specs 13 Mem Bers had caused prices to Tumble to a Low of $7 a barrel earlier this year before recovering to $ 14 a barrel now. Yamani was fired in a Royal decree oct. 29, a move interpreted by Gulf officials As a reversal of the saudi policy aimed at stable Oil prices. On Friday Nazer said saudi Arabia would stick to an output quota of 4.3 million barrels a Day until the year s end As decreed by pc Al its last meeting in Geneva thai ended oct. 22. This u against a previous production level of around 6 million barrels a Day. Nazer added however that the target Price of s18 a barrel could nol be attained without similar commit ments by All other members. The government denied he was kidnapped. The Cabinet statement is the first official israeli confirmation that Sanunu who disappeared from London almost six weeks ago was in Israel. Foreign news reports had said Sanunu was kid napped in England by agents from Mossad Israel s intelligence Agency to stand trial on treason Cabinet statement said speculation that Van no had been kidnapped is baseless Bui it did not say How he returned to said he is being held in Israel under a court order. The order was issued after a court hearing at which Sanunu was represented by an attorney of his own Choice the statement said. A spokesman for prime minister Yitzhak Shamir said Sanunu was arrested according to Law and will be tried according to the spokesman Yossi Ahi Meir said that the government decided to end its silence about the Case to balance he wave of James Bond stories that were being the sunday times of London in an oct. 5 article queued Sanunu As saying that Israel had produced nuclear weapons making it the world sixth nuclear Power. The newspaper published photographs it said we retaken secretly by Sanunu when he worked at the i Mona nuclear facility in Southern Israel for 10 years. Both reactors along with a third unit were shut Down last april after an explosion Tore open the no. 4 reactor Al chernobyl and released a Cloud of radiation that was selected around he world. The second generating unit has been recommit is oud at he chernobyl nuclear Power Plant after the first was put into service radio Moscow s English language service said. It added thai special measures were taken to in crease the safely of the reactor and All Plant equip the news reports did not specify when the tests began on the reactor but implied that they had started recently. Soviet newspapers reported in Early october that the no. 1 reactor had been restarted for tests. Pravda Laid sunday that the unit had been shut Down again for "corrective1 work then returned to service. It gave no other details. Pravda also quoted experts As saying prospects Aregood for restarting the no. 3 reactor adjacent to the ruined no. 4 unit but did not say when thai might be attempted. It said work was continuing to encase the no. 4 reactor in Concrete. An explosion shattered the no. 4 reactor Block last april 26 during an Experiment with steam powered turbines. At least 31 people have died at a result of the disaster which caused More than $2.9 billion in dam age and forced the evacuation of More than 100,000 people from their Homo in the Northern Ukraine and Southern byelorussian. Earlier soviet newspaper reports said Lou of Power from the i million kilowatt reactors i chernobyl and delays in completing three new reactors elsewhere have caused a deficit of 6 million kilowatts in National electricity supplies. Bill government Energy officials have been quoted As saying that the shortage should Date by the end of this year As the chernobyl units Are restarted and new reactor Are commissioned. Sukarno s widow Hanini Sukarno receive the Honor on behalf of her late husband. Former vice president Mohammad halt who died in 1980, also was honoured. Sukarno and Malta proclaimed the nation in dependent from the Netherlands on aug. 17, 1955. Sukarno was placed under House arrest after an abortive communist coup in 1965, in which at least 100,000 people died. Sukarno died in 1970. Indonesia celebrates heroes Day on nov. 10 in Honor of Siose who died in the struggle for Independence.
